Service 'Spooler' failed to start. Verify that you have sufficient privileges to start system services." -- "Error 1921.Service 'Spooler' could not be stopped. Verify that you have sufficient privileges to stop system services." Detail A device driver or another service may be bound to the Windows Printer Spooler service. If you have a Lexmark printer, then this may be caused by the Lexmark LexBCE service. Solution 1: Disable all non Microsoft services and startup items, and then reinstall Acrobat or Acrobat 3D. (Windows XP only) 1. Disable startup items and restart Windows in Selective Startup mode: a. Choose Start > Run. b. Type msconfig in the Open text box, and then click OK. b. Click the Services tab, click Hide All Microsoft Services, and then click Disable All. c. Click the Startup tab, click Disable All, and then click OK. d. In the System Configuration dialog box, click Restart. e. In the Desktop dialog box, click OK to start Windows. 2. Start the Acrobat installer and follow the on-screen instructions.
